EDITORS COMMENTS
This enchanting photograph captures a precious moment in the lives of Alice Liddell, her sisters Lorina and Edith, as they frolic in a garden, rekindling memories of their childhood adventures in the late 19th century. The sisters, who were the inspiration for Lewis Carroll's beloved character Alice in "Alice's Adventures in Wonderland," are seen here in 1934, many years after the publication of the iconic novel. Their playful antics and infectious laughter convey a sense of joy and innocence that transcends time. Alice Liddell, born in 1852, was the eldest of thirteen children in a prominent Oxford family. Her father, Henry Liddell, was the Dean of Christ Church College at the time, and her mother, Lorina, was a talented artist. Carroll, a close friend of the family, often entertained the children with stories and games, which led to the creation of "Alice's Adventures in Wonderland." Edith Liddell, born in 1861, was the third eldest sister and the youngest of the three featured in this photograph. Lorina Liddell, born in 1856, was the second eldest. The sisters' childhood experiences with Carroll and the creation of Alice's adventures left a lasting impact on their lives, and this photograph serves as a poignant reminder of their shared history and the magical world they once inhabited.
